Brian: All of them but one says that Agent Krycek is evil. The one...the one that didn't say he's evil said that Krycek is a fallen angel. A fallen angel. Now you said you had your own theory.

Nick: I like the idea of that. Somebody told me when I was in England that they thought I was maybe the anti-hero. Or the, uh, sort of the dark side....Mulder's...Mulder's dark side, which I thought was interesting. And then I think it was good for my ego as well, but... I've always seen the guy as a survivalist and he's always willing to do whatever it takes in order to stay alive and stay afloat. I don't think....

Brian: So he does what he's got to do.

Nick: Yeah! And even on the show last weekend, I don't - I don't think that....I mean, I tried to bring some... I mean, it was so cold and so hard when I read it, you know that he had me sewing up this boy's face and ears, and I said, I said that I've got to bring some humanity to this thing or it just going to...he's just going to be a hateful person. I tried to do that, I don't know whether it happened or not.

Brian: Well, does it bother you, that he's evil, or you don't think he's evil?

Nick: No, as I was saying before to somebody, it's...it's kind of a not...it's not a good idea to make that choice as an actor anyway. To see your character as being evil. You know, you want to see your character as being good, because then it will, it sort of fills out the corners, you know. A little bit.

Brian: Lost an arm, let's see, you've been in an explosion, you been in a silo with alien goo... [Nick grins]

Nick: I get beat up every episode.

Brian: Are you doing your own stunts?

Nick: Yes.

Brian: You are!?

Nick: Well, the one hanging form the building, that was fun because what they originally....like I was cabled in by one arm. And the idea was I was supposed to stand on a platform and then they would only shoot me down to the knees so no one would see my feet. Well, that's not really very interesting. I mean, you want to see the person hanging, you want to see the perspectives and you want to see the feet dangling. So they took away the platform and hung me from 17 floors by one arm. And that was...and I was...

Brian: Exhilarated? [laughs]

Nick: To say the least!
